The size of Woonona is approximately 7.7 square kilometres. It has 30 parks covering nearly 11.4% of total area. The population of Woonona in 2016 was 12187 people. By 2021 the population was 12374 showing a population growth of 1.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Woonona is 40-49 years. Households in Woonona are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Woonona work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.90% of the homes in Woonona were owner-occupied compared with 71.90% in 2016.
